More worryingly is the price. As I mentioned over at Kotaku, if they keep the same prices for the US release, we should expect to pay around $55 for the entire game across 1 year:

Base game + Chapter 1: Free (Released September 6th, 2010)
Chapter 2: 525 yen (~$6.50 USD)
Chapters 3 - 10: 315 yen (~$4.00) each, total: 2520 yen ($31.65 USD)
Chapter 11: 525 yen
Chapter 12, 13: 420 yen ($5.27) each, total: 840 ($10.54 USD) (Released August 8th, 2011)

Total: 4410 yen ($55 USD) Source: Wikipedia

Chapter 11, 12, and 13 were more expensive, but were also larger, and considered the "ending" (or climax if you want to get fancy) chapters, apparently, with all the plot points coming together and all that. EDIT: It's seem the job sprites are updated from the original release. If you check the website for the original cellphone game you will see that most of the jobs used modified versions of FF5 job sprites and that most characters used the same sprites but with different colors.
